7K a year 8 days ago 8 days ago 8 days ago The region's leading network of healthcare providers, Inspira Health is seeking a full-time Social Worker to provide social work services and psychosocial/family assessments, including dialysis, collaborate with the interdisciplinary team in discharge planning for high-risk patients and develop and implement psychosocial activities.
You will also be responsible for documenting both group and individual patient care intervention and outcomes in a timely manner.
Qualifications:
Master's Degree in Social Work from an Accredited School of Social Work 1
years of experience (post-master's) in social work or related psychiatric field with demonstrated working knowledge of DSM IV manual, community resources, discharge planning activities, basic leadership skills and decision-making Current New Jersey licensure required as a licensed social worker (LSW) or licensed clinical social worker (LCSW) Find your inspiration.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
